Clutch Noise
There's a bearing called the the release bearing or throw-out bearing. If the grease drys out, it will begin to squeal when you depress the clutch. Bearing probably only needs to be cleaned and repacked w/ grease.
However,...accessing the bearing requires removing the transmission :<(
Sometimes the noise will resolve itself, if a little grease melts and coats the bearings.
